Winner of quilt raffle announced

Congratulations to Becky Horowitz, winner of the Friends of the Round Rock Public Library’s quilt raffle. The Friends raised more than $800 in ticket sales.

About the Quilt

A lap sized appliqued quilt full of puns, color and movement created by Dale Ricklefs. Can one find where there is a pun about Divergent? How about Thirteen Reasons Why? Bone City? Some puns are obvious, one or two are a bit more obscure. Special thanks to Dale Ricklefs

About the Friends

The Friends of the Round Rock Public Library, 501(c)(3) provide funding and manpower to enhance Round Rock Public Library services to library users. They build library support among community members through events such as the Summer Reading Program, a monthly November membership program, and the Mystery Night community fundraiser usually held in the Spring. They also raise funds through an ongoing used book sale.
